
FRESNO, Calif. (KFSN) -- Millions of PG&E households and eligible small businesses will see a Climate Credit applied to their bill this month.
Residential households with an active natural gas account will receive a natural gas credit of $46.26.
Small business owners will receive an electric credit of $36.18.
No action is needed by customers.
In March, the California Public Utilities Commission voted to pause the residential electric credit until later this year to coincide with high-usage months.
